سؤال

لدي الآن قاعدة بيانات (حوالي 2-3 جيجابايت) في PostgreSQL، والتي تعمل بمثابة مخزن بيانات لتطبيق يشبه RoR/Python LAMP.

ما هي الأدوات المتوفرة البسيطة والقوية بما يكفي لنسخ قاعدة البيانات الرئيسية إلى جهاز ثانٍ؟

لقد بحثت في بعض الحزم (Slony-I وغيرها) ولكن سيكون من الرائع سماع قصص من الحياة الواقعية أيضًا.

الآن أنا لست مهتمًا بموازنة التحميل وما إلى ذلك.أفكر في استخدام إستراتيجية Write-Ahead-Log البسيطة في الوقت الحالي.

هل كانت مفيدة؟

المحلول

إذا كنت لا تقوم بالنسخ المتماثل، فإن سجلات الكتابة المسبقة هي الحل الأبسط.

نصائح أخرى

إذا كان بإمكانك الترقية إلى الصفحة 9، فإنني أتطلع إلى النسخ المتماثل للبث - إعداد بسيط للغاية.أو إذا لم تتمكن من الترقية، يمكنك فقط إلقاء نظرة على وضع الاستعداد السريع (الذي يمكنك الاستعلام عنه).

انظر هنا: http://eggie5.com/15-setting-up-pg9-streaming-replication

مرخصة بموجب: CC-BY-SA مع الإسناد
لا تنتمي إلى StackOverflow
scroll top